**Akasa Air Joins IATA, Strengthening Its Global Presence**

Akasa Air, India’s newest airline, announced on January 9 that it has officially become a member of the International Air Transport Association (IATA). This milestone follows the airline’s successful completion of the IATA Operational Safety Audit (IOSA), a prerequisite for airlines aspiring to join the prestigious global aviation body.

Founded in 2020 by aviation entrepreneur Vinay Dube, Akasa Air has been steadily expanding its operations and now joins a global community that includes over 360 carriers worldwide. This membership positions Akasa Air alongside major players in the international aviation sector, including four other Indian airlines: Air India, Air India Express, IndiGo, and SpiceJet.

Sheldon Hee, IATA’s Regional Vice President for Asia-Pacific, expressed enthusiasm about Akasa Air’s membership, highlighting India’s vast aviation potential, which supports 7.7 million jobs and contributes USD 53.6 billion to the economy.

Currently operating a fleet of 31 Boeing 737 MAX aircraft, Akasa Air serves 26 domestic destinations and six international cities, continuously expanding its reach in key markets. Vinay Dube, the airline’s Founder and CEO, stated that IATA membership will enhance the airline’s global credibility and establish it as a forward-thinking Indian airline on the world stage.

The late investor Rakesh Jhunjhunwala significantly supported Akasa Air, investing nearly $35 million for a 40% stake in the company. Recently, the airline has attracted additional investments from prominent institutional investors, including Premji Invest, 360 ONE Asset, and Claypond Capital, further solidifying its financial foundation.
